## Working with special content
 
### Just marking content for parsing
- In Ruby/HAML:
```ruby
_('Subscribe')
```
- In JavaScript:
```js
import { __ } from '../../../locale';
const label = __('Subscribe');
```
Sometimes there are some dynamic translations that can't be found by the
parser when running `bundle exec rake gettext:find`. For these scenarios you can
use the [`_N` method](https://github.com/grosser/gettext_i18n_rails/blob/c09e38d481e0899ca7d3fc01786834fa8e7aab97/Readme.md#unfound-translations-with-rake-gettextfind).
There is also and alternative method to [translate messages from validation errors](https://github.com/grosser/gettext_i18n_rails/blob/c09e38d481e0899ca7d3fc01786834fa8e7aab97/Readme.md#option-a).
### Interpolation
 
- In Ruby/HAML:
 
```ruby
_("Hello %{name}") % { name: 'Joe' }
_("Hello %{name}") % { name: 'Joe' } => 'Hello Joe'
```
 
- In JavaScript: Not supported at this moment.
- In JavaScript:
```js
import { __, sprintf } from '../../../locale';
sprintf(__('Hello %{username}'), { username: 'Joe' }) => 'Hello Joe'
```
